The power is currently out across a swath of Glover Park and upper Georgetown, an area bounded approximately by P St. NW, MacArthur Blvd., W St. NW, and Wisconsin Ave. NW.
Pepco is already on the scene, but there’s currently no estimated time of repair. The power company is estimating that 1,500 customers are affected.
We’re hearing that traffic signals are out on Foxhall and Reservoir roads, and maybe others. You may want to avoid the area on your evening commute.
